Kapatagan, Lanao Del Sur

Kapatagan, officially the Municipality of Kapatagan (Maranao: Inged a Kapatagan; Tagalog: Bayan ng Kapatagan), is a 4th class municipality in the province of Lanao del Sur, Philippines. According to the 2020 census, it has a population of 20,498 people.

History

On February 8, 1982, Batas Pambansa Blg. 168 was approved; 36 barangays in Balabagan were separated to create Kapatagan, with one with the same name designated the seat of government. A plebiscite for ratification, along with ten more newly-created local entities, was held on May 17, coinciding with the barangay elections.

Barangays

Kapatagan is politically subdivided into 15 barangays. Each barangay consists of puroks while some have sitios.

  • Bakikis
  • Barao
  • Bongabong
  • Daguan
  • Inudaran
  • Kabaniakawan
  • Kapatagan
  • Lusain
  • Matimos
  • Minimao
  • Pinantao.
  • Salaman
  • Sigayan
  • Tabuan
  • Upper Igabay

Demographics

Population census of Kapatagan
YearPop.±% p.a.
1990 5,784—    
1995 6,702+2.80%
2000 7,804+3.32%
2007 19,598+13.54%
2010 13,432−12.85%
2015 15,521+2.79%
2020 20,498+5.62%
Source: Philippine Statistics Authority
